Getting There
-
Public Transport
To reach Akiri Surf Retreat from Malé International Airport (MLE), take the public ferry to Malé city. The airport ferry runs every 15 minutes during the day and costs MVR 15. From the MTCC Ferry Terminal in Malé, take the public ferry to Thulusdhoo. This ferry typically operates on Sundays, Mondays, Tuesdays, Wednesdays, and Thursdays. The ferry costs approximately $3 per person and the journey takes around 90 minutes. Upon arrival at the Thulusdhoo ferry terminal, Akiri Surf Retreat is a short walk or a brief taxi ride away. Note: The public ferry to Thulusdhoo does not operate on Fridays. Confirm the latest ferry schedules in advance, as they can vary. Costs: * Airport ferry: MVR 15 * Malé to Thulusdhoo ferry: $3 (approximately)

Speedboat
For a faster and more convenient journey from Malé International Airport (MLE) to Akiri Surf Retreat, take a speedboat. Several speedboat operators offer transfers to Thulusdhoo. The journey takes approximately 30 minutes. It is recommended to book your speedboat transfer in advance, especially during peak season, through your accommodation or online. Speedboats typically depart from the Villingili Ferry Terminal in Malé. Upon arrival at the Thulusdhoo harbor, Akiri Surf Retreat is a short walk or taxi ride away. Costs: * Speedboat transfer: $25 - $50 per person
